TCP에 대해서 초등학생도 알 수 있도록 설명을 해봤어요.

1510 단어 패킷합의TCP

전제 지식: 통신 프로토콜은?


○○○ 통신 시××이런 규칙에 따라 교환하다.
합의를 일본인에 비유하면'대화할 때 일본어로 하자'는 느낌이 든다.
갑자기 우주어로 말해도 99%는 이해 못하죠?
하나의 대화라도 규칙은 자연스럽게 완성된다.

TCP는 부식입니까?


통신에 사용되는 규칙 중 하나입니다.주된 규칙은'안전을 중시하여 통신하는 것'이다
TCP를 사용하는 통신 중
  • 발송자가 데이터를 발송
  • 수신자가 받았습니다!이렇게 전달한다.
  • 발송자가 받았습니다!라고 답장을 보내며 "잘 보냈죠"라고 말했다.이렇게 하면 안심할 수 있다.
  • 접수 시도 33!의 답장이 오지 않으면 데이터를 한 번 더 보내면 된다
  • TCP 의 특징


    중점을 보내면서 교환하는지 확인하기 때문에 다음과 같은 특징이 있다.
  • 누설 없이 전파될 가능성이 높다
  • 느려짐
  • TCP는 무엇을 제공합니까?


    클라이언트(사용자)와 서버(공급자)가 서로 통신하는 상태인지 확인
    연결된 네트워크라고 불리는 도로적인 물건을 만들어 데이터 교환을 했다.
    연결 설정은 다음 세 가지 교환을 통해 이루어진다.

    데이터를 발송할 수 있습니까?(SYN)


    고객은 SYN 그룹으로 불리는 데이터를 서버에 전송하여 연결을 요청합니다.
    대략적인 설명을 하자면 고객은 "데이터를 보내도 됩니까?"라고 말할 것이다.이런 문제는 서버로서의 느낌.
    ※ 패킷은 통신신용의 세분화된 데이터를 말합니다.

    데이터 발송 가능합니다!(ACK)


    TCP에서는 안전한 통신을 위해 데이터를 보낸 뒤 상대방의 회신을 확인한 뒤 데이터를 보내야 한다.이 확인 방법은 ACK 그룹화입니다.대충 설명하자면'보내면 OK'.이렇게 대답하는 느낌.

    데이터 발송 가능합니다!나도 데려다 줄 수 있어?(ACK+SYN)


    상술한 두 가지 행위를 단숨에 진행하다.
    고객이 먼저 SYN(발송 가능)서버 상대
    좋아!(ACK) 여기서도 데이터를 보낼 수 있습니까?(SYN).

    좋은 웹페이지 즐겨찾기